Transaction 1bbdeef6f9b575dcc2c87a00945cbf0d4cab0630d9f5100335538add9d265d5c

block
39a8c4cbf50339f229af8fbba7baeef6f5b5e0247e0c26610338b77420b0c278

1 Input

998 Outputs